Output edc89dbfa3479ea9fdacfe32e623edde86ad19b98c1778ecf98d08e59e2ea950:1

value
1425187375
script pubkey
OP_0 OP_PUSHBYTES_20 4dfbfb0ec5d6de977ef3e6492ede12f75ce059e2
address
bc1qfhalkrk96m0fwlhnueyjahsj7awwqk0z4nkmjg
transaction
edc89dbfa3479ea9fdacfe32e623edde86ad19b98c1778ecf98d08e59e2ea950
spent
true